Valley Air District Employees Win Agency Shop!

SJVAPCD Fresno Group

November 19, 2008

More than two-thirds of the 225 San Joaquin Valley Air Pollution Control District General Unit Employees overwhelmingly voted to make our union stronger through Agency Shop. Finally, we stand united...

Workers at Rebekah Children’s Services Protest for Respect

Workers at Rebekah Children’s Services Protest for Respect

Normally, workers at Rebekah Children's Services are a mild-mannered group. So there had to be a good reason why 50 workers spent their lunch break Tuesday, Nov. 18 picketing the place of their employment.

Community Solutions Workers Protest...

Community Solutions Protest

...Bad Faith Bargaining by Management
Fighting for a fair contract, about 80 workers marched and chanted Wednesday, Nov. 12, along a busy thoroughfare in Gilroy to protest management refusing even a Cost of Living Adjustment for workers at Community Solutions.

Measure A Passed!

Measure A

SEIU 521 Members Help Pass Measure A. Santa Clara County voters overwhelmingly said "YES" to earthquake safety for Valley Medical Center, passing Measure A with a solid 77.9 percent this November Election.

Historic Strike Hits Tulare County

Tulare Co Strike 10-2008

Tulare County government came to a standstill as more than 1,000 county workers waged an unprecedented one-day strike Wednesday, Oct. 8, to say we will accept nothing less than a fair contract and livable wages.
